Payments, Earnings, Refunds, and Chargebacks Policy
MIDsource readiness, paid access, 80/20 split, reserves, refunds, chargebacks, taxes, and payout controls.
Payment processor
Noodi expects to use MIDsource or another approved high-risk payment partner for creator-platform payments. Payment availability, settlement, fraud review, payout timing, chargeback handling, card network rules, and prohibited transaction rules are subject to the active processor, bank, gateway, and card network.
Creator earnings
The standard creator split is 80% creator / 20% Noodi. Noodi may lower its platform commission for eligible creators over time based on loyalty, tenure, volume, compliance, promotional terms, or written creator-program rules.
Earnings shown in dashboards are estimates until settled. Final payout eligibility depends on processor settlement, verification status, tax status, payout approval, reserves, refunds, chargebacks, fraud review, and compliance review.
Refunds
Digital subscriptions, vault unlocks, paid messages, custom request deposits, and creator access purchases are generally final once access is delivered or made available, unless law, processor rules, or Noodi discretion requires a refund.
Noodi may refund duplicate charges, technical access failures, confirmed fraud, unavailable content, creator misconduct, policy violations, or processor-required reversals.
Chargebacks and disputes
Chargebacks and payment disputes may result in user suspension, creator payout reserve, creator balance offset, access removal, investigation, or account termination.
Creators may be responsible for chargebacks, penalties, refunds, and processor fees connected to their content, promises, misconduct, fraud, policy violations, non-delivery, or illegal activity.
Taxes
Creators are responsible for tax compliance. Noodi may require W-9, W-8BEN, payout account information, legal name, address, tax ID, and additional documentation before payouts. Noodi may withhold, report, or delay payments as required by law or processor rules.
